League Army

The League Army is the military force of the Free Faces League and the second most advanced military amongst its peers. A part of the Coalition Defense Forces, the League Army provides the steely defensive backbone that the Coalition of Breakaway Colonies requires to survive the lightning-fast onslaughts of the Grand Army of Voxelia.

Structure

The League Army is hierarchical in structure. Separate command structures were established for each of the three theaters in the War of Reunification to which League territories are adjacent. Each of these theater commands coordinates with local elements of the CDF, but ultimately answers to central command elements in Triple Mesa. In terms of rank structure, the League Army is separated into enlisted (with separate routes for mandatory enlistees and voluntary carreer enlistees), non-commissioned officer, and officer corps. Promotion occurs as a result of a combination of demonstrated merit and time in grade, but NCO and CO ranks can only be attained in a second or later term of service to weed out those with an insufficient level of commitment to the cause.

Culture

The League Army embraces a doctrine of total war and defense-in-depth as a counter to their Voxelian counterparts' fast attack doctrine. Generally, once the League Army takes a position, they entrench and never give it back, especially when backed with allied logistical support. While members of the CDF from the Commonwealth of C might brag about their precision dieseltech devices, and those from Craterhold can lay claim to the strongest offensive fervor, neither of them would be able to support the Coalition without the strong defense that the League provides. The League Army knows this fact and takes pride in it.

Public Agenda

The Free Faces League requires all citizens to undertake a two- to four-year term of military service upon reaching the age of majority, the completion of which confers the franchise and the right to carry weapons in public. While League Army members might not possess the self-selected zeal that comes with voluntary service, they come into the service already inculcated in a culture that promotes public service and a certain martial spirit as a matter of tradition, making the job of training sergeants that much easier. Making sure that every citizen has some degree of military training neatly dovetails with the League Army's long-standing doctrine of defense in depth; were Voxelia to invade the League's heartland, they would find holding onto the territory nearly impossible as a result of the hardened insurgency that would inevitably follow.

Assets

The League Army makes liberal use of auto-armor, including the classic PBA-5 "Pioneer" Main Battle Auto-Armor and the formidable BF-6 "Fortress" Mobile Stronghold Auto-Armor provided by the League Dieseltech Armory. The League Army also has a well-developed aerospace program, using airships and autogyros, like the ACG-1 "Aquila" Combat Autogyro, to support their ground forces in combined arms actions.
